- [ ] **Step 7: Breaker override escrow.** After sealing the signing keys for the Tallgrove upstream API circuit breaker, confirm the support team can force the breaker open during a full outage. The override bundle lives in the sealed escrow drawer and is useless without its unlock phrase. Two ceremony witnesses must initial this step before proceeding. The escrow bundle is decrypted with the recovery passphrase that follows.

vault phrase of kahip-kahop = holath-quenmir

Subject: Release handover — AgriLink Gateway. Hi Dorn, handing over the telemetry gateway release duties for FieldPulse. Pipeline is green, firmware 4.1 is staged, and the rollback plan is in the runbook. For your security review: signing happens on the build host, verification on-device. The only sensitive item transferring with this handover is the deploy key, included below.

signing key of bagap-yawep = bky13_TbfT6ZMUoGJo2

## Tuning

Formatrix resolves date patterns per locale at runtime. Plugins must not cache resolved patterns longer than the TTL below — locale packs can hot-reload. Fallback depth controls how far up the locale chain we walk before defaulting; keep it shallow or lookups get slow. All values are overridable via plugin manifest, but defaults work for most regions. The shipped defaults are listed below.

tuning constants:
QUOTAS = {
    "druwyn": 5,
    "holix": 5,
    "zorath": 5,
    "holwyn": 10,
}

Management Meeting Minutes — Legacy Pricing

Attendees reviewed the proposed 8% increase for legacy Fernhollow customers. Churn modeling suggests limited attrition. Notice letters draft in progress; effective date set for Q2. Support staffing deemed adequate. The board is asked to ratify at the next session. The pricing decision ties to the plan noted below.

internal memo for hahif-hahaf: Headcount on the Zorwyn team goes from 9 to 100 by the end of October. Gross margin on Zorwyn came in at 5 percent against a plan of 10 percent.